Key Facts
- New York state income tax on $16,020,000 is $1,553,323 — 9.70% of gross income.
- Combined with federal taxes and FICA, total tax burden is $7,817,781 (48.80%).
- Take-home pay is $8,202,219, or $683,518 per month.
- NYC residents pay additional 3.078%–3.876%; Yonkers adds 1.477%
$16,020,000 Income Tax Breakdown in New York
| Tax | Amount | Eff. Rate |
|---|---|---|
| Federal Income Tax | $5,878,870 | 36.70% |
| New York State Income Tax | $1,553,323 | 9.70% |
| Social Security (6.2%) | $10,918 | 0.07% |
| Medicare (1.45%+) | $374,670 | 2.34% |
| Total Tax | $7,817,781 | 48.80% |
| Take-Home Pay | $8,202,219 | 51.20% |
